Elliott Erwitt, a photographer born in Paris in 1928 and now based in Nyo York. Elliot Erwitt, who was interested in photography when she was 11 years old, fled to the United States to escape the horrors and was an assistant in the darkroom in Hollywood, and studied photography at the City College in Los Angeles. I moved to New York at the age of 20 and began working as a full-fledged photographer in 1949. Elliot, who was nominated by Robert Capa at age 25 and joined the photographer group Magnum, and later served as chairman, added a documentary as a photo journalist, as well as a wit and humorous perspective on the daily scene. I gained a global reputation through my work including publishing, magazines and advertising. This book "To the Dogs" is a photobook published in conjunction with the exhibition held in Japan in 1992, entitled "Classic" and the first half of a picture of a dog that is one of Elliot's masterpieces. It is a two-part composition of the second half of the masterpiece of Elliot. This book is also a good introduction to Elliott. Photographer signed (Signed) .
